Thousands are expected to pack Belgrave Park this Saturday as Abergavenny Round Table puts on its biggest fireworks display to date.
The annual event will see the sky over Abergavenny filled with a spectacular and colourful carnival of flash, panache and things that go boom.
Held since 1969, the event draws in thousands each year and this November 5 the organisers have made sure things will go off with a bang by choreographing the fireworks with music from well loved movies.
Fireworks officer Matt Lane explained, “This has been a real challenge to pull this one off, and it’s certainly not one to be missed.”
Abergavenny Round Table is made up of a group of local volunteers who spend hours putting on the event for the local community.
All funds raised from the event go directly into local charities and worthwhile causes in the Abergavenny and District area.
Treasurer Chris Copner added, “This is our biggest fundraiser of the year and we are expecting record numbers.”
Abergavenny Round Table would like to thank its local sponsors this year for helping them increase the size of the display.
As always food and drink will be available on site along with children’s fun fair.
The events will be held Saturday, November 5 at Belgrave Park. Gates open at 6pm.
In keeping with tradition, this year Abergavenny Round Table asked local schools to design a fireworks safety poster.
Matt Lane told the Chronicle,
“There were lots of great entries and it was very tough to judge but we managed to pick the winners, who will each receive a family ticket, plus a child’s ticket for each of the other children in their class and a £50 donation to the school.
“The runners up will also receive a family ticket to the display.”
